問題タブ [geopoints]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- GPSデータの保存形式
GPS データを Sqlite データベースに保存しようとしています。DDMS 経由で KML ファイルからデータを取得し、次の方法で GeoPoint に保存します。
問題はGeoPoint()
、double 形式で定義されていないため、lon と lat を int としてのみ受け入れることです。経度が 45.3242355 の場合、これは int-453242355 として Sqlite に保存されます。そして、これを使用して地図上のジオポイント間に線を引きたいのですが、この整数形式は緯度と経度の範囲外であるため、できます。実際の形式のデータを取り戻すにはどうすればよいか教えてもらえますか?
android - アンドロイドは、始点と終点の間の線を横切る点の配列の間に線を引きます
私はこれをしました:
それは機能し、すべての点の間に線を引きます。唯一の問題は、最初のポイントと最後のポイントの間に、他のポイントのパス上で交差する線もあるということです。どうすれば削除できますか?
facebook-graph-api - Facebook open graph tag errors (geopoint)
The following meta tags produce the linter warning below. I read on a blog or two that facebook no longer uses these tags, but given their interface, I have a hard time believing it. Does anyone see any problems?
Open Graph Warnings That Should Be Fixed
Extraneous Property: Objects of this type do not allow properties named 'og:latitude'.
Extraneous Property: Objects of this type do not allow properties named 'og:longitude'.
Extraneous Property: Objects of this type do not allow properties named 'og:street-address'.
Extraneous Property: Objects of this type do not allow properties named 'og:locality'.
Extraneous Property: Objects of this type do not allow properties named 'og:region'.
Extraneous Property: Objects of this type do not allow properties named 'og:postal-code'.
Extraneous Property: Objects of this type do not allow properties named 'og:country-name'.
android - Androidのmapviewジオポイント差分エミュレーターとデバイス
mylocationクラスを使用してgpsプロバイダーからデータを取得しています。コードはこれです:
エミュレーター(2.3.3)でアプリを使用すると、何も乗算せずに正しい場所が表示されます。
しかし、デバイス(4.0)で使用する場合、latとlonに1000000を掛ける必要があります。理由がわかりませんでした。アンドロイドのバージョンのせいではないと思います。誰かが何か考えがありますか?
android - 2 つのジオポイントの方向を知る方法
私は3つのジオポイントを持っています
(開始位置)11.986242477259117, 79.84657287597656`
(中間位置)11.984521304799278、79.84583258628845
(終了位置)11.985014568760436、79.844491481781
How to draw a path on a map using kml file?から知識を得ました。
そして、このようにジオポイント間に線を引きました。
経度と緯度の値を使用して2つの場所間の距離を計算する方法を使用して距離を計算しました
私の質問は、ユーザーが「A」(開始位置)の近くに立っているとき、方向を伝えたいのですが、このように「北」、「東」、「西」、「南」に移動する必要があります。
ユーザーが誤って他の方向に移動した場合は、「You have mov wrong direction」のように伝え、正しい方向を言う必要があります。
2つのジオポイント間の方向を取得する方法.?
Get direction (コンパス) から 2 つの経度/緯度ポイントで度を取得しました
ある程度は戻りますが、正しい方向はわかりません。
2つのジオポイント間の方向を取得する方法.?
android - Androidで画面座標をジオポイントに変換する方法
Androidマップビューで画面座標をジオポイントに変換しようとしています。画面の中央にマーカーを表示する必要があります(マップビューがウィンドウに表示されます)。そこで、ディスプレイ メトリック getWidth() および getHeight() メソッドを使用して中心座標を取得し、mapView.getProjection().fromPixels(height/2, width/2) を使用して geoppoint に変換しようとしました。しかし、それは間違った結果を与えているようです。何をすればよいでしょうか?
android - GoogleMaps GeoPoint 値の範囲
マップにいくつか追加しようとしGeoPoints
ましたが、いくつかの「特別な」ポイントに問題があります。
緯度値の範囲は+90から-90なので、このようにポイントを追加したい...
...そして、この後、緯度の値を次のように再確認します。
私は常に80000000の最大値を返します。Googleがこの制限を設定しGeoPoint
た理由と、この制限の理由を誰かが説明できますか?
ありがとう!
android - 2 つのジオポイント間の Android ショーの運転方向ルート
2 ~ 3 日間グーグルで検索しましたが、問題の完全な解決策を見つけることができません。
2 つのジオポイント間のルートを表示する必要があります (直線ではなく、運転方向の種類のルートを表示する必要があります) が、これに対する解決策を見つけることができません。私はこの質問で解決策を見つけました。
しかし、解決策も機能していないと思います。あなたが私を助けることができれば、それは素晴らしいことです.
私は解決策を見つけました以下の答えを探してください...
android - AndroidGeopointの文字列をintに変換する
GoogleプレイスのURLから緯度と経度を文字列として取得しています。次に、取得した座標を使用して地図上にピンを配置したいと思います。GeoPointの文字列を整数に解析しようとしているため、何かがおかしなことになります。結果は0,0と表示されるため、ピンはアフリカの海岸から離れた場所に配置されます。これが私のコードです:
エラーは整数の解析にあると思います。
構文解析では、座標の小数点が表示され、異常が発生すると思います。では、GeoPointが座標文字列を30.487263、-97.970799のように正しくフォーマットされた座標として表示するように、座標文字列を整数に解析するにはどうすればよいですか。
android - GoogleMap アプリの NullPointerException で Android 強制終了
このアクティビティでは、データベースのテーブル ミッションから緯度と経度を取得し、マーカー イメージを使用してマップに配置します。
ログ猫でヌルポインタ例外で強制終了しています...
}
これは logcat のトレースです: